To authenticate new clients using the ZeroMQ CURVE security mechanism,
we have to check that the client's public key matches a key we know and
accept. There are numerous ways to store accepted client public keys.
The mechanism CZMQ implements is "certificates" (plain text files) held
in a "certificate store" (a disk directory). This class works with such
certificate stores, and lets you easily load them from disk, and check
if a given client public key is known or not. The {@link org.zeromq.ZCert} class does the
work of managing a single certificate.
* Those files need to be in ZMP-Format which is created by {@link org.zeromq.ZConfig}
